Reiner’s Untimely Demise and Film Delay
Rob Reiner and his wife, Michele Singer Reiner, were found dead in their home in early December 2025, a discovery made by their daughter, Romy Reiner. Hours after this shocking find, their son, Nick Reiner, was arrested and charged with two counts of first-degree murder. This unexpected family tragedy has indefinitely postponed the release of Reiner’s anticipated final film, Spinal Tap at Stonehenge: The Final Finale. The film was set to be a concert sequel to his iconic 1984 mockumentary.
Distributors Bleecker Street have put the release on hold, awaiting the Reiner family’s decision on how to proceed. This delay not only affects the film’s release but also the legacy of Reiner, who’s renowned for his contributions to cinema, including This Is Spinal Tap, When Harry Met Sally, and The Princess Bride. The movie was poised for a 2026 release, following the success of Spinal Tap II: The End Continues earlier that year, but now faces an uncertain future.

Impact on the Film Industry and Reiner’s Legacy
The delay has sent ripples through Hollywood, not just due to the film’s potential box office success but also because of Reiner’s storied career and activism. Known for his advocacy on issues like early childhood development and gay marriage, Reiner’s sudden departure leaves a significant void. The industry is now grappling with how to honor his legacy while managing the sensitive nature of the circumstances surrounding his death. The cast and crew, including Christopher Guest, Michael McKean, and Harry Shearer, who were integral to the film, are left in limbo.
The situation also highlights the challenges faced by distributors like Bleecker Street, who must balance commercial interests with respect for the family’s wishes.
